WebGlycemic Index (GI) Food Guide - Diabetes Canada Information regarding the glycemic index of amaranth is not widely available, but at least one published study estimated the glycemic index to range between 87 and 106 based on the preparation method. Other studies report that it to be as high as 107, making this a high glycemic food. WebGlycemic load = Glycemic index xGrams carbohydrate / 100 . Here is an example: • The glycemic index for raw carrots is 71 . A ½ cup serving has about 8 grams of available carbohydrates. 71 x 8 = 568 / 100 = 5.7 glycemic load . A glycemic load of 10 or less is low, a glycemic load of 11 to 19 is medium, and a glycemic load of 20 or more is high.
